Look ma! No hands!

Wherever I go, I find the most interesting people with interesting stories about their buses or vanagons. Regardless of the year they owned it, people speak about their memories like they owned the bus yesterday. There is no ego here, people who approach me are genuine cool, the real deal. Easy going good time charlie's with a hint of regret lingering in their voice when they talk about the VW van they used to have. I have yet to meet anyone who hated their bus and wished they never owned it. (now that is not to say we haven't muttered those words under our breath as we try to figure out what the hell is wrong with this thing or that...)

My friend Bill came by to check out the van one day. Being a former owner in the 70's with a classic campervan, he told me tales of their adventures when they were younger, taking their daughter from place to place, enjoying every moment of it.
"You know," Bill said, "A buddy of mine and I took one of these things (pointing to the bus) and drove east of Edmonton down highway 16 using nothing more than the vent windows to steer it"!
"What?" I exclaimed, not truly appreciating what he was getting at. Picture these two young guys getting up to highway speed, letting go of the wheel and then navigating on the road using the wind resistance caused by opening the side vent windows. Man! To be a child of the 60's hey?? That had to have been just the funniest damn thing ever! I don't recall exactly how many miles they got before having to make a grab for the wheel, but I remember thinking "holy shit that's a long way to go"! And this isn't exactly the straightest road either, there were some curves for them to deal with. Bizarre. Now, I would like to see Bill try that again... LOL Just don't use my van!
